So anyone in modern times?A few times. Jack Brabham, Bruce McLaren, Dan Gurney all won GPs driving their own cars, Brabham an F1 world championship, McLaren a couple of CAN-AM titles. Others to combine running a team and driving include John Surtees, Graham Hill, Wilson Fittipaldi, Chris Amon, Arturo Merzario and Silvio Moser. No doubt there were others.

Oh, and while he was a resident of the Isle of Man, Nigel Mansell was for 11 years a Special Constable for the Manx Police.
...and when he left the Isle of Man it was to run the Woodbury Park Hotel and Golf Club which he bought in 1994 (i.e. as a sideline shortly before retiring from CART and F1.)
